During which phase of mitosis do the chromosomes align along the metaphase plate, making it an ideal stage for coloring chromosome arrangements in a diagram?
A
Metaphase
B
Prophase
C
Anaphase
D
Telophase
Verified step by step guidance
1
Understand the phases of mitosis: Mitosis consists of Prophase, Metaphase, Anaphase, and Telophase. Each phase has distinct characteristics and roles in cell division.
Recall the key feature of Metaphase: During Metaphase, chromosomes align along the metaphase plate (the equatorial plane of the cell). This alignment ensures that chromosomes are evenly distributed to the daughter cells.
Compare the phases: Prophase involves chromosome condensation and spindle formation, Anaphase involves the separation of sister chromatids, and Telophase involves the reformation of the nuclear envelope. None of these phases involve chromosome alignment along the metaphase plate.
Recognize why Metaphase is ideal for diagramming: The alignment of chromosomes along the metaphase plate provides a clear and organized view of chromosome arrangements, making it visually ideal for coloring or diagramming.
Conclude that the correct phase for chromosome alignment along the metaphase plate is Metaphase, based on its defining characteristic.
